Output e5f4d0caee060d93be4d06e6661545cf10d051be4aa3b946cfe65a605958222f:6

value
84559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8954495a43ef3ea0abbe7ee939dd9486852c4071 OP_EQUAL
address
3ED9U9yW4oosDHYtV8MEGs48yyUsLUUZn4
transaction
e5f4d0caee060d93be4d06e6661545cf10d051be4aa3b946cfe65a605958222f
confirmations
326477
spent
true